Where Is Area Code 973?
Area code 973 is in northern New Jersey. It serves Newark and many nearby communities in the northern part of the state. The region sits just west of New York City and is part of the larger New York metropolitan area.
Area code 973 covers all or parts of Essex, Passaic, Morris, and Sussex counties. Major cities and communities in the 973 area include Newark, Paterson, Morristown, Passaic, Bloomfield, Montclair, West Orange, Wayne, Parsippany-Troy Hills, and Dover. Newark is the largest city commonly tied to the area code.
The 973 area includes urban, suburban, and rural places. It reaches from dense cities like Newark and Paterson to parts of the Highlands and the Kittatinny Valley in Sussex County. Notable places in the broader 973 region include the Great Falls of the Passaic River in Paterson, Branch Brook Park in Newark, and parts of the Watchung Mountains.
History of Area Code 973
Area code 973 was created on June 1, 1997. It was split from area code 201, which had originally covered all of New Jersey in 1947 under the North American Numbering Plan. The split happened because northern New Jersey needed more telephone numbers as population and phone use grew.
Area code 862 was added as an overlay to 973 on November 1, 2001. That change meant new numbers in the same geographic area could use either 973 or 862. Because of the overlay, 10-digit dialing became necessary for local calls in the 973 region.
Key Facts About Area Code 973
- Area code 973 is in New Jersey, and Newark is the major city most often associated with it.
- Area code 973 serves northern New Jersey, including all or parts of Essex, Passaic, Morris, and Sussex counties.
- Area code 973 is in the Eastern Time Zone.
- Area code 973 was created on June 1, 1997, in a split from area code 201.
- Area code 862 overlays area code 973 and began service on November 1, 2001.
- Area code 973 covers important cities and towns such as Newark, Paterson, Morristown, Montclair, Wayne, and Parsippany-Troy Hills.
- The 973 region includes well-known sites such as the Great Falls of the Passaic River, a National Historical Park in Paterson.
- Major institutions in the 973 area include New Jersey Institute of Technology in Newark, Montclair State University in Montclair, and Rutgers University-Newark in Newark.
